Adventure Update Coming To Minecraft 360

None

According to 4J Studios, the first Minecraft Xbox 360 update will be the equivalent of the PC version’s Beta 1.7.3. This includes piston functionality, giving players yet more flexibility when building their fantasy pixelated dream worlds. However, according to a recent interview with OXM, this update is actually rather simple. Much trickier, though, is the update to version 1.8.2.

For those of you who don’t remember, 1.8 (and its various iterations) was colloquially called the “Adventure Update.” This update added an insane amount of new mobs, terrain features, and even gameplay mechanics. It also introduced Creative Mode, which essentially allows players complete creative freedom. It makes them invulnerable, gives them infinite blocks of every type, and allows them to fly. It’s the perfect thing for the person who simply wants to play with the Minecraft equivalent of a never-ending set of LEGOs.



Unfortunately, bringing new features over to the Xbox 360 Edition is not as simple as copy/pasting the code over from the PC version. The Xbox 360 uses an entirely different architecture, and patching an executable on a console has been said to be somewhat like pulling teeth… your own teeth… with a rusty clamp. Still, the team says it’s up for the challenge.
